Abstract
A knowledge-based system architecture called IPEX is presented that uses a time-distributed, interactive reasoning paradigm for process control applications. Structural features of the system are presented, and it is shown that temporal considerations are included in each of the system's data structures either explicitly or implicitly. Diagnostic planning is discussed, and explanations of the algorithms that formulate and maintain diagnostic/control plans are given. In particular, it is shown that the IPEX system can manage concurrently executing interactive diagnostic plans for multiple problem hypotheses.
